IRMA's focus is industrial, rather than small or artisanal mines. The IRMA standard concentrates on social and ecological methods of mines, and has actually been established by a broad stakeholder group that consists of mining business, jewelers, and other "downstream individuals," nongovernmental organizations, influenced neighborhoods, and organized labor. In 2018, IRMA is supplying a launch phase of qualification for interested mines.


Some refiners are ready to segregate gold for processing, commonly at extra expense. Refiners consisting of PX Prcinox (Switzerland), Metalor (Switzerland), S&P Trading (France), and gussa (Austria) all refine Fairmined gold, segregating it from the other gold that they refine. Use recycled gold can aid prevent the human civil liberties dangers and environmental injuries connected with newly-mined gold, as long as companies perform due diligence; nonetheless, making use of recycled gold is not safe either, as it can be utilized for money laundering or wrongly identified as reused.

Tiffany and Co, established in 1837, is a luxury jewelry expert with over 300 shops throughout 27 nations. Its 2016 revenue was approximately $4 billion, with fashion jewelry standing for 92 percent of its globally sales


Tiffany reacted to Human Rights Watch's demand for information with a composed, thorough letter and met with Human Legal right Watch staff in individual. Tiffany has partial chain of guardianship over its diamonds, and can map some of its have a peek here rubies to specific mines. On the basis of available info, Human being Civil liberty Watch considers Tiffany and Co. to have actually made strong efforts to ensure human rights due diligence.


The Diamond Box Fundamentals Explained


Chain of custody: Tiffany and Co. has complete chain of protection over its gold supply chain. Twenty-seven percent of its gold comes from a single mine in Utah, the Bingham Canyon Mine, and the continuing to be 73 percent comes from recycled resources. It sources all of its recycled gold from one provider, which has the capability to segregate gold from extracted and from recycled sources.
